Block

#21,708,343
Block Number
21,708,343 @ 05/13/2025, 07:24:30
Status
Finalized
ID
0x014b3e37d252b889b3297f5be6acac2defb1de8913018bbf9d2668fd52f89243
Transactions
Gas Used
18967400/40000000 (47.42% Used)
Total Score
198,182,530 (+14)
Rewards
56.90 VTHO